Carbohydrates - Part of a Healthy Diet
The best sources of carbohydrates are:
- fruits
- vegetables
- whole grains
These all deliver essential vitamins and minerals, fiber, and important phytonutrients.
Adding Good Carbohydrates
For optimal health, get your grains intact from foods such as whole wheat bread, brown
rice, whole grain pasta, and other grains like quinoa, whole oats, and bulgur. These
foods help protect you against a range of chronic diseases.
Suggestions for adding more good carbohydrates to your diet:
- Start the day with whole grains. If you're partial to hot cereals, try old-fashioned
or steel-cut oats. If you're a cold cereal person, look for one that lists whole
wheat, whole oats, or other whole grain first on the ingredient list.
- Use whole grain breads for lunch or snacks. Check the label to make sure that
whole wheat or another whole grain is the first ingredient listed.
- Replace potatoes with brown rice or grains like bulgur, wheat berries, millet, or
hulled barley with your dinner.
- Try whole wheat pasta. If the whole grain products are too chewy for you, look
for those that are made with half whole-wheat flour and half white flour.
- Beans Bean, Beans. Beans are an excellent source of slowly digested
carbohydrates as well as a great source of protein.
